School Council
Meet our School Council Representatives!
Our school council meet on a termly basis, they get together to discuss matters and issues which may affect the children and their learning. The council comprises of 2 children from each class nominated by their peers to act as their representatives. The representatives from Year 6 will laise and represent Reception and Year 1 to ensure their voices are heard.

Some of our School Councillors attended the Inner South Youth Summit 2022 at the Leeds Civic Hall, where they got to meet Councillors from across Leeds. They engaged in activities to increase awareness of local democracy and the importance of voting and getting involved in their community. There were explanations of opportunities for youth voice Youth Council, Children’s Mayor, Members of Youth Parliament and Youth Matters Groups. There was a Q&A session and a budget session where the children had to discuss and decide on where best to spend their budget in the community. Kings and Queens for the day May 2023
Your School Councillors decided that one of the ways to celebrate the recent King Charles' Coronation, would be for each class to have their own King and Queen. Children had to decide form the the children who put themselves up for the vote with a secret ballot. The chosen ones were then crowned and had privileges within their class for the day. Later that afternoon, we all got together for a royal treat, thanks to Sue Smith, our dinner lady, who provided cakes, buns and biscuits.
